NivuFlow Mobile 550 - Self-Sufficient Flow Metering using Radar

The manufacturer’s NivuFlow Mobile 550 detects the flow rate in water by using CW-Doppler-Radar. Latest hydraulic models allow for highly accurate flow measurements within usual channel shapes. New Radar Transmitter

The new transmitter in combination with a radar sensor enables contactless flow measurement in open channels and part filled pipes. FIFTY!

At the 1st of June 1967, company founder Udo Steppe started his own business founding NIVUS. In a time when the first microwave oven was introduced and the first ATMs were put into operation, Udo Steppe began trading in measurement systems for bulk solids and liquids.
